Output 6c72e26a36eac09f9708be0910feb5ebe394e52bdabd799bcfa19a9052d33941:21

value
34026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044a956d2d3b8ce0599a7149ba3d722aa7d55cfb OP_EQUAL
address
325hyUdZjX7vRaa1azCDvQaK57a7vSjMAn
transaction
6c72e26a36eac09f9708be0910feb5ebe394e52bdabd799bcfa19a9052d33941
confirmations
305760
spent
true